Friend, the mortgage is not the only number. Ownership includes maintenance.

Plan for These Annual Costs

HVAC servicing
Pest control
Lawn care
Minor plumbing fixes
Appliance repairs
HOA fees if applicable

A good rule of thumb is to save one percent of your home's value annually for maintenance. For a three hundred thousand dollar home, that is about three thousand dollars per year. That breaks down to two hundred fifty dollars per month.

Create a Maintenance Account

Separate from emergency savings, label it Home Care. Transfer funds monthly because preparation prevents panic.
